Comment exécuter un script dans Google Sheets

Copy the Google Sheets Data

Bonjour les amis ! Aujourd’hui, je vais vous révéler comment exécuter un script dans Google Sheets pour des fonctionnalités personnalisées et puissantes.

Configuration du script

Pour exécuter un script dans Google Sheets, vous devez l’ajouter à votre feuille de calcul. Voici comment faire :

Étape 1

Ouvrez le menu Extensions et choisissez « Apps Script » pour accéder à l’éditeur de script. Si vous n’avez pas encore basculé vers le nouveau menu, vous trouverez l’éditeur de script dans le menu Outils.

Étape 2

L’éditeur de script s’ouvrira dans un nouvel onglet du navigateur. Supprimez le texte existant de la zone de l’éditeur.

Étape 3

Tapez ou copiez-collez le script que vous souhaitez exécuter. Si vous n’avez pas de script déjà prêt, vous pouvez utiliser le code suivant qui écrit « Bonjour le monde » dans la cellule sélectionnée.

function helloWorld() {
  const cell = SpreadsheetApp.getActiveSpreadsheet().getActiveSheet().getActiveRange();
  cell.setValue("Bonjour le monde");
}

Étape 4

Ajoutez cette balise à votre code pour vous assurer que le script affecte uniquement la feuille de calcul actuelle.

/**
* @OnlyCurrentDoc
*/

Étape 5

Donnez un nom à votre projet de script en cliquant sur l’en-tête « Projet sans titre » et en saisissant un nom descriptif. Pour cet exemple, nous appellerons le projet « Bonjour le monde ».

Étape 6

Cliquez sur le bouton de sauvegarde pour enregistrer votre script.

Étape 7

Le script est maintenant prêt à être exécuté.

Exécution de votre script

La première fois que vous exécutez un script dans Google Sheets avec un compte Google donné, vous devrez autoriser le code à s’exécuter. Voici comment procéder :

Étape 1

Dans l’éditeur de script, assurez-vous que le script que vous souhaitez exécuter est sélectionné dans la liste déroulante « Sélectionner la fonction à exécuter », puis cliquez sur le bouton « Exécuter ».

Étape 2

Attendez l’apparition de la fenêtre contextuelle, puis cliquez sur « Examiner les autorisations ».

Étape 3

Sélectionnez le compte sous lequel vous souhaitez exécuter le script.

Étape 4

Vérifiez les autorisations répertoriées, puis cliquez sur « Autoriser » si vous acceptez d’accorder ces autorisations au script et que vous faites confiance à la source.

Étape 6

Le script est maintenant autorisé. Cliquez une fois de plus sur « Exécuter » pour exécuter le script et coller « Bonjour le monde » dans la ou les cellules actives.

Exécuter un script à partir d’un bouton

Il est possible d’exécuter des scripts directement depuis la feuille de calcul. Voici comment procéder :

Étape 1

Ouvrez le menu « Insérer » et choisissez « Dessin ».

Étape 2

Utilisez les outils de l’Éditeur de dessin pour créer un bouton, puis cliquez sur « Enregistrer et fermer » pour l’ajouter à votre feuille de calcul.

Étape 3

Sélectionnez le bouton et cliquez sur les trois points qui apparaissent pour ouvrir le menu, puis choisissez « Attribuer un script ».

Étape 4

Tapez le nom de la fonction que vous souhaitez exécuter exactement tel qu’il apparaît dans l’Éditeur de script. Ensuite, cliquez sur « Ok ».

Étape 5

Vous pouvez maintenant exécuter le script en cliquant sur le bouton.

En résumé

Dans ce tutoriel, je vous ai montré comment exécuter un script dans Google Sheets pour ajouter des fonctionnalités personnalisées à vos feuilles de calcul. Si vous voulez en savoir plus, consultez tous les tutoriels Google Sheets sur Crawlan.com. À la prochaine les amis, et profitez bien de vos super feuilles de calcul !

Articles en lien